In recent years, pharmacological research has directed its attention to studying the potential biological activities of plant extracts, given the increasing utilization of plants for treating several ailments worldwide and since they are generally considered as safer and possessing minor side effects compared to synthetic drugs. In particular, there is now an outstanding number of studies on the cytotoxic and antioxidant effects of plant extracts. We seek to further underline the importance of these studies by publishing new research or review articles on this Topic. There are no limitations on the type of plant, extracts, or assays used, but phytochemical analyses must fully explain the positive or negative results of the plant extracts from a phytochemical standpoint.
